Quiet Operation & Low Maintenance
Another reason heat pumps are growing in popularity is their quiet, low-maintenance design. Unlike traditional systems that rely on combustion or noisy compressors, heat pumps operate quietly and with fewer moving parts. This means less wear and tear over time, lower maintenance costs and a more peaceful living environment.

How Heat Pumps Work in Melbourne Homes
Heat pumps are one of the most energy-efficient ways to heat water in Melbourne homes, and they’re becoming increasingly popular as households look to reduce energy costs and move away from gas. A heat pump hot water system works by extracting warmth from the outside air and using it to heat water stored in a tank, rather than generating heat directly like traditional electric systems. This process is similar to how a refrigerator works in reverse and allows heat pumps to use significantly less electricity while still providing reliable hot water.
Despite Melbourne’s cooler winters, modern heat pump systems are specifically designed to perform efficiently across a wide range of temperatures. They use advanced refrigerant technology and a compressor to capture available heat from the air, even on cold mornings, and convert it into usable energy for hot water. Because of this, the heat pumps Melbourne homeowners install are well-suited to the city’s changing seasons and varied climate. Proper placement and professional installation are important to ensure consistent airflow and maximum efficiency.
Heat pumps are a great fit for Melbourne homes because they offer lower running costs, reduced reliance on gas, and strong performance when paired with solar power systems. Frequently Asked Questions
How much do heat pumps in Melbourne cost to be installed?
The cost of heat pumps in Melbourne depends on the system size, capacity, and installation complexity. Typical installation prices (before rebates) can range from a few thousand dollars, with final costs influenced by factors like electrical upgrades or site-specific needs. Available government rebates like the Victorian Energy Upgrades (VEU) program can significantly reduce your upfront investment.
What rebates can I get for heat pumps Melbourne?
For hot water heat pumps melbourne, the key programs are: Solar Victoria hot water rebate (up to $1,000, or up to $1,400 for eligible locally made products), Victorian Energy Upgrades (VEU) hot water discounts, and federal STCs for eligible models on the Clean Energy Regulator register. Eligibility depends on household/property criteria and the system being replaced, so your installer should confirm in writing which incentives apply and what evidence is required.
Can heat pumps in Melbourne be installed in a garage or indoors?
Sometimes, but it depends on airflow and the specific system type. Heat pump hot water units extract heat from surrounding air; restricted airflow can reduce efficiency and shorten lifespan, so many installs are outdoors or in well-ventilated locations. If refrigerant pipework work is required (common for split systems), confirm the installer holds the correct licences for the work. A site assessment should check clearances, noise placement, drainage, and safe electrical isolation.
Do heat pumps in Melbourne need a switchboard upgrade or new circuit?
Some homes will need electrical upgrades, others won’t. Heat pump hot water systems are generally efficient, but older Melbourne properties may have limited spare capacity or outdated switchboards. The best approach is an electrical assessment before installation so the quote includes any required new circuit, isolator, or switchboard work, ensuring the system runs safely and reliably (and meets rebate/compliance requirements).
How long do heat pumps melbourne last?
Service life depends on model quality, installation quality, water conditions, and maintenance. The typical lifespan is 10–15 years, which aligns with common industry expectations for well-installed systems. Longer life is more likely when the unit has good airflow, correct pipework, safe electrical protection, and periodic service.
